826380bd8dSJohn Johansen /*
836380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* The xindex is broken into 3 parts
846380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* - index - an index into either the exec name table or the variable table
856380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* - exec type - which determines how the executable name and index are used
866380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* - flags - which modify how the destination name is applied
876380bd8dSJohn Johansen  */
886380bd8dSJohn Johansen #define AA_X_INDEX_MASK		0x03ff
896380bd8dSJohn Johansen 
906380bd8dSJohn Johansen #define AA_X_TYPE_MASK		0x0c00
916380bd8dSJohn Johansen #define AA_X_TYPE_SHIFT		10
926380bd8dSJohn Johansen #define AA_X_NONE		0x0000
936380bd8dSJohn Johansen #define AA_X_NAME		0x0400	/* use executable name px */
946380bd8dSJohn Johansen #define AA_X_TABLE		0x0800	/* use a specified name ->n# */
956380bd8dSJohn Johansen 
966380bd8dSJohn Johansen #define AA_X_UNSAFE		0x1000
976380bd8dSJohn Johansen #define AA_X_CHILD		0x2000	/* make >AA_X_NONE apply to children */
986380bd8dSJohn Johansen #define AA_X_INHERIT		0x4000
996380bd8dSJohn Johansen #define AA_X_UNCONFINED		0x8000

1106380bd8dSJohn Johansen /* struct file_perms - file permission
1116380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* @allow: mask of permissions that are allowed
1126380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* @audit: mask of permissions to force an audit message for
1136380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* @quiet: mask of permissions to quiet audit messages for
1146380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* @kill: mask of permissions that when matched will kill the task
1156380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* @xindex: exec transition index if @allow contains MAY_EXEC
1166380bd8dSJohn Johansen  *
1176380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* The @audit and @queit mask should be mutually exclusive.
1186380bd8dSJohn Johansen  */
1196380bd8dSJohn Johansen struct file_perms {
1206380bd8dSJohn Johansen 	u32 allow;
1216380bd8dSJohn Johansen 	u32 audit;
1226380bd8dSJohn Johansen 	u32 quiet;
1236380bd8dSJohn Johansen 	u32 kill;
1246380bd8dSJohn Johansen 	u16 xindex;
1256380bd8dSJohn Johansen };

1836380bd8dSJohn Johansen /**
1846380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* struct aa_file_rules - components used for file rule permissions
1856380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* @dfa: dfa to match path names and conditionals against
1866380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* @perms: permission table indexed by the matched state accept entry of @dfa
1876380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* @trans: transition table for indexed by named x transitions
1886380bd8dSJohn Johansen  *
1896380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* File permission are determined by matching a path against @dfa and then
1906380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* then using the value of the accept entry for the matching state as
1916380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* an index into @perms.  If a named exec transition is required it is
1926380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* looked up in the transition table.
1936380bd8dSJohn Johansen  */
1946380bd8dSJohn Johansen struct aa_file_rules {
1956380bd8dSJohn Johansen 	unsigned int start;
1966380bd8dSJohn Johansen 	struct aa_dfa *dfa;
1976380bd8dSJohn Johansen 	/* struct perms perms; */
1986380bd8dSJohn Johansen 	struct aa_domain trans;
1996380bd8dSJohn Johansen 	/* TODO: add delegate table */
2006380bd8dSJohn Johansen };

2226380bd8dSJohn Johansen /**
2236380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* aa_map_file_perms - map file flags to AppArmor permissions
2246380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* @file: open file to map flags to AppArmor permissions
2256380bd8dSJohn Johansen  *
2266380bd8dSJohn Johansen  * Returns: apparmor permission set for the file
2276380bd8dSJohn Johansen  */
2286380bd8dSJohn Johansen static inline u32 aa_map_file_to_perms(struct file *file)
2296380bd8dSJohn Johansen {
23053fe8b99SJohn Johansen 	int flags = file->f_flags;
23153fe8b99SJohn Johansen 	u32 perms = 0;
23253fe8b99SJohn Johansen 
23353fe8b99SJohn Johansen 	if (file->f_mode & FMODE_WRITE)
23453fe8b99SJohn Johansen 		perms |= MAY_WRITE;
23553fe8b99SJohn Johansen 	if (file->f_mode & FMODE_READ)
23653fe8b99SJohn Johansen 		perms |= MAY_READ;
2376380bd8dSJohn Johansen 
2386380bd8dSJohn Johansen 	if ((flags & O_APPEND) && (perms & MAY_WRITE))
2396380bd8dSJohn Johansen 		perms = (perms & ~MAY_WRITE) | MAY_APPEND;
2406380bd8dSJohn Johansen 	/* trunc implies write permission */
2416380bd8dSJohn Johansen 	if (flags & O_TRUNC)
2426380bd8dSJohn Johansen 		perms |= MAY_WRITE;
2436380bd8dSJohn Johansen 	if (flags & O_CREAT)
2446380bd8dSJohn Johansen 		perms |= AA_MAY_CREATE;
2456380bd8dSJohn Johansen 
2466380bd8dSJohn Johansen 	return perms;
2476380bd8dSJohn Johansen }
